ā́-hata mfn. struck, beaten, hit, hurt, [R.]; [Ragh.]; [Kum.]; [Kathās.]; [VarBṛ.] &c.
fastened, fixed, [RV.]; [AV.]
beaten, caused to sound (as a drum &c.), [MBh.]; [Hariv.]; [Ragh.] &c.
crushed, rubbed, [Śiś.]
rendered null, destroyed, frustrated, [BhP.]; [VarBṛS.]
multiplied, [VarBṛS.]
hit, blunted (said of a Visarga, when changed to o), [Sāh.]
uttered falsely, [L.]
known, understood, [L.]
repeated, mentioned, [L.]
ā́-hata m. a drum, [L.]
ā́-hata n. old cloth or raiment, [L.]
new cloth or clothes, [L.]
assertion of an impossibility, [L.]
